    Abstract: An apparatus and method for predicting hot form die sliding are disclosed. The apparatus generates a 3D model of a hot form die, including a model upper die and a model lower die, which is fixed, relative to the model upper die. A hot forming process model is generated, and a baseline simulation is performed to determine a sliding direction of the model upper die within a sliding plane as it is pressed towards the model lower die along a z-axis. A spring coefficient is calculated at a spring reference point on the model upper die, that allows the model upper die to slide a specified distance in the sliding direction. If it is determined that some sliding is to be prevented, the apparatus generates model guides within the 3d model.

    Abstract: A vehicle driver monitoring system includes a supervisor computerized device and an operator computerized device. The system may also include a key container device. The devices of the vehicle driver monitoring system work in conjunction with each other to monitor various aspects of the user's operation of a corresponding vehicle during use. If a key container device is used, the devices also work to limit the operability of a vehicle key. For example, the supervisor computerized device is configured to remotely receive vehicle monitoring information, such as location information, speed information, and operator information, from the operator computerized device as the operator drives the vehicle. Further, the optional key container device is configured to selectively allow to the operability of a vehicle key based upon vehicle access info, identity and sobriety information as related to the user and as provided by the operator computerized device.

    Abstract: Aspects of the invention are directed towards profiling computer programs that include interpreted functions. Various implementations provide for profiling a computer program, written in a first programming language, which includes an interpretive function that can execute a computer program, written in a second programming language. During profiling, when the interpretive function is called, the functions of the computer program written in the second programming languages are profiled.

    Abstract: A computer-implemented method for providing online advertising is provided. The method includes providing, by a video delivery module, online video content to a user and maintaining, by a tracking module, a content consumption counter tracking an amount of time the user has watched the video content. The method also includes preventing, by a blocking module, the user from controlling playback of the video content if the content consumption counter satisfies a time characteristic. The method further includes providing, by an advertisement delivery module, a portion of an advertisement section to the user during the preventing. The duration of the portion of the advertisement section is dependent on the time characteristic.

    Abstract: Apparatus and methods are provided for generating real-time measured latency data. A message is generated with a time stamp. The time stamp indicates a time the message was sent. The time the message was sent is determined based on a reference-clock source, such as a Global Positioning System (GPS) satellite. A time that the message was received is determined using the reference-clock source. The real-time measured latency data is determined based on the time stamp and the time the message was received. If user data is present in the message, the user data is determined by removing the time stamp from the message. The time stamp and the time the message was received may be generated using a latency-measuring device that is configured to communicate with the reference-clock source. The latency-measuring device may be aboard an un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V) or an unmanned ground vehicle (UGV).
